In Psalm 2, David states that when rebel leaders start crap-talking God and attempt to dispense with His decrees, God mocks them. Yep, Jehovah’s amused at these presumptive idiots who wish to lead a nation without giving God honor by adhering to His way.

And God doesn’t just laugh, as you’re about to see, He gets ticked off, and that’s bad news bears for the fools attempting to cast loose from God’s gracious moorings. And remember, this warning is for all leaders, of all time, at home or abroad.

Ergo, dear Christian, instead of chewing your fingernails down to the nub and buying the fear that saddles the faithless, why don’t you pray out loud Psalm 2 that David prayed and penned many moons ago? This is a practical way Christians can throw a heavenly punch during these hellacious days. Pray this Psalm out loud with some Holy Ghost attitude.

Psalm 2

1 You are wondering: What has provoked the nations to embrace anger and chaos?
Why are the people making plans to pursue their own vacant and empty greatness?
2 Leaders of nations stand united;
rulers put their heads together,
plotting against the Eternal One and His Anointed King, trying to figure out
3 How they can throw off the gentle reign of God’s love,
step out from under the restrictions of His claims to advance their own schemes.
4 At first, the Power of heaven laughs at their silliness.
The Eternal mocks their ignorant selfishness.
5 But His laughter turns to rage, and He rebukes them.
As God displays His righteous anger, they begin to know the meaning of fear. He says,
6 “I am the One who appointed My king who reigns from Zion, My mount of holiness.
He is the one in charge.” (VOICE)
